Dear All,

I need a simple / Cheapest boat Kit/RTR to act as a rescue for my seaplanes.
Saw this on HK :

http://www.hobbyking.com/hobbyking/store/__17899__HobbyKing_Swamp_Dawg_Air_Boat_ARR_.html

Have something like this in mind. Open to other options also.

Request Boat experts to help pls.

Aviator..for rescue purposes, an air boat is best..with multiple thrust control..its all easy..and can operate any water, even with weeds..a normal craft with a conventional prop never work in weedy water..a full covered thrust chambered craft will be even better, and can control with pinpoint accuracy..you can make one yourself within a day..a 1000 RPM, ECM, with 5 inch three bladed prop will do the best..a 12 volts 1.2 amps SLA battery will do very nicely, up to 40 minutes in controlled load..and the little extra weight of battery will give you a better control without drifting..cool... a craft in A4 size will not do the job..if you are serious about a rescue boat, to save your water based planes, it must be a little bigger one..i already done some crafts for my Colleagues..all it are in to 38 inches long and wides in to 20 inchess..it will be a twin boat layout..and with a long gap, in between, so can lock the plane within the gap, to rescue..and if your craft is too small, it will not be able to deal with a rescue mission, especially, on a windy day..a conventional, rudder with THV will give you more 100% directional control, for a good maneour..can turn in 360 degree from a stand still..you can make it from foam board, and can add two more pontoons in both sides, for added safety..you can make one craft within a three hours or so..best electronics for this purpose is a 6 inch three bladed prop,with a 1000 RPM ECM, with a 20 Amps (theoratically) ESC..and can use a SLA battery is cheap, about 200 Rs for 12 volts..so, the craft will be some heavy, well within control..while typing and reading it seems as a big thing in making..but when you start to build, it will be esay as cake and eheese..if you need it i can make one for you..but you must bare the cost for the materials and electronics..with a Duplexed DXing 2.4 GHz radio, you can send this craft to kilometers away..
